Table 1.
Star-formation rate and Hα equivalent width for the F3D galaxies.
Object | czgas | SFR | SFRup | EW(Hα) | EW(Hα)up | Notes on star formation |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
(km s−1) | (M⊙ yr−1) | (M⊙ yr−1) | (Å) | (Å) | ||
(1) | (2) | (3) | (4) | (5) | (6) | (7) |
FCC 090 | 1756.5±0.2 | 0.035 | 0.038 | 21.46 | 23.22 | Pervasive |
FCC 113 | 1323.4±0.3 | 0.042 | 0.042 | 29.63 | 30.05 | Pervasive |
FCC 119 | 1340.1±0.2 | 0.001 | 0.002 | 0.87 | 1.20 | Central |
FCC 167 | 1850±16 | 0.000 | 0.003 | 0.00 | 0.06 | Traces in the centre |
FCC 179 | 828±9 | 0.155 | 0.228 | 4.95 | 7.26 | Extended star-forming ring |
FCC 184 | 1230±2 | 0.008 | 0.082 | 0.26 | 2.54 | Circumnuclear star-forming ring |
FCC 219 | 1948±1 | 0.000 | 0.000 | 0.00 | 0.00 | No star formation |
FCC 263 | 1664±1 | 0.282 | 0.285 | 50.65 | 51.07 | Pervasive |
FCC 285 | 831.6±0.2 | 0.145 | 0.149 | 75.47 | 77.31 | Pervasive |
FCC 290 | 1334.1±0.3 | 0.127 | 0.148 | 12.52 | 14.62 | Pervasive |
FCC 306 | 823.6±0.4 | 0.016 | 0.016 | 15.29 | 15.49 | Pervasive |
FCC 308 | 1464.0±0.4 | 0.167 | 0.170 | 36.22 | 36.81 | Pervasive |
FCC 312 | 1871±1 | 0.751 | 0.783 | 54.33 | 56.65 | Pervasive |
Notes. (1) Galaxy name from Ferguson (1989). (2) Heliocentric systemic velocity from the ionised-gas velocity field. (3) Star formation rate. (4) Upper limit of the star formation rate derived by assuming that also all the Hα emission from transition regions is powered by O-type stars. (5) and (6) Hα equivalent width and its upper limit. (7) Notes about the star formation activity.
